An album of Japanese coloured woodblock prints, various dates, comprising; Kitagawa Utamaro (Japanese, circa 1756-1804), a tea-stall waitress holding a fan, from the series 'Eight Views of Tea-stalls in Celebrated Places' (Meisho koshikake hakkei), the sheet 38 x 26cm; another Kitagawa Utamaro woodblock print, Pleasure Parties in Boats on the Sumida River under the Ryogoku Bridge, with inscription for publisher Yamamoto Omiya, the sheet 28 x 20cm; together with a set of twelve further woodblock prints after Kitagawa Utamaro, 'Women weaving Silk Cloth'; and three further prints; a woman after the bath, Torii Kiyonaga, three beauties after Kikugawa Eizan, and another print of a group in an interior, sharing a meal of fish; some of the album pages with copyright labels for 'The West of Japan International Tourism & Products Company'
